How they compare

Croatia currently reports 98.6% against 91.7% in UNICEF: Latin America and Caribbean, a difference of 6.9%.

That makes Croatia's figure about 1.1 times UNICEF: Latin America and Caribbean's.

Across all 20 years both countries report, Croatia has been ahead every year.

Croatia ranks 21st and UNICEF: Latin America and Caribbean ranks 19th of 166 countries.

Croatia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Croatia UNICEF: Latin America and Caribbean Difference Ahead
2000s 91.6% 84.5% 7.1% Croatia
2010s 95.5% 90.6% 4.9% Croatia
2020s 99.1% 92.3% 6.8% Croatia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
